Enter the colourful world of Indigo Wilde and the magical creatures she takes care of ... including some new giants who are causing ENORMOUS trouble! A wonderfully wild series, winner of the Alligator's Mouth Book Award; for readers of 7+ and fans of Pippi Longstocking and Amelia Fang. Indigo and her brother Quigley live in a house secretly full of magical Creatures. Indigo is never happier than when feeding chocolate to the fire-breathing rabbit or making nests for the colourful hophop birds. She loves a challenge! But when a giant appears in the garden she has an enormous problem on her hands. Can Indigo and Quigley help the giant save his sister, against all the odds? Indigo will need help from all her friends in both the Known and Unknown Worlds to save the day. Gorgeously illustrated in full colour throughout, this is the third in the series - have you read Indigo Wilde and the Creatures at Jellybean Crescent, winner of the Alligator's Mouth Award?

Pippa Curnick grew up in rural Essex and studied at Camberwell College of Art. She graduated from the University of Derby with a First Class degree in illustration. Pippa's picture book Lucie Goose was shortlisted for the Evening Standard's Oscar's First Book Prize.
